For an election or primary, polls in Connecticut are open from 6 a.m. to 8 p.m. Any elector standing in line at the polls at 8 p.m. will be allowed to cast a vote. The Registrars of Voters are jointly responsible for proper voting machine and polling place preparation, poll worker hiring and training, and other duties as required by Connecticut Election Law. In addition to mailing a regular ballot, Connecticut provides a State Special Blank Write-In Absentee Ballot up to 90 days before the election to Uniformed Service members and their eligible family members unable to vote in the regular absentee voting process due to military contingencies. You must be: A U.S. citizen; A bona fide resident of a Connecticut town; At least 18 years old (Seventeen-year-olds that will be 18 by Election Day may register up to 180 days before the election.)
